Here are the known's of a chassis:
Inlet open area = 17 inches^2
Outlet open area = 30 inches^2
Internal Fans = 270 cfm (3 fans @ 90 cfm each)

What is the CFM through the system and what's the equations used to figure this out?

I assume that if we had a very small inlet or outlet open area the pressure will build and decrease the CFM. I want to know if my fans will be choked or if they will run at 270cfm.

There's just no way to answer your question with any certainty given the small amoutn of information you've provided. Personally I don't think it would be particularly difficult to flow 270 cfm through 17 in^2, but it depends on a lot more than just area.
